Well, there are many things that make the EC have a reputation of being slow.
One thing is just the transition periods you mention, then there is the delays caused by the need to have legislation at the EU levels turned into actual national legislation to be implemented.
Then there is the whole trialogue thing where, after first approving a draft law, the EP and the EC have to hold further negotiations on a common text while supervised by the Council, which tended to happen behind closed doors so the experience is that the contentious law that was just approved is quietly sucked into a black hole and then you might hear of it being passed only many many months later.
Finally, we also have instances like with the Chapter 7 investigations against Orban where the commission knows the council is likely to block any conclusions so there's no point in rapidly pushing ahead.